I signed up for eharmony August 31,2007 and paid a fee of $59.95 for a trial of the service for the month of September. The service was not what I expected it to be so I decided not to participate and assumed the $59.95 was the end of it.

On October 1, 2007 my account was charged another $49.95, I phoned eharmony on October 1, 2007 and could not get through to customer service. I phoned 1-800-263-6133 again on October 3, 2007, I spoke with Karen R. who said she was the manager.(she would not give me her last name said the company would not allow them to give out their last name.)

I told her I did not authorize the charge and wanted it to be refunded to my credit card. She gave me some garbage about how I agreed to an automatic renewal, which I did not and would not agree to. Sounded like she was reading a script the company had given her.

The charge was for the month of October. I told her to close my account and refund the $49.95 which I would not be using for October. I told her fraud had been committed, that I did not authroize the charge and wanted a refund. She absolutely refused, said they did not give refunds. I ask her why I would continue to be charged if I would not be using the service for the month of October , she just kept reading some script and saying I agreed to auto renewal on page 3 and 4, needless to say she refused to give me a refund.
Then I called back and talked to someone in billing named Seville, when I told her I was recording a phone conversation she hung up the phone.

Eharmony is a ripoff company, beware of their services, they will charge your credit card with unauthorized charges. They are using deceptive practices to deceive their customers!!!! I am contacting the BBB, the Attorney General and persuing a class action law suit! Sherry Stalcup
